What to look for in a Carly AI alternative
Start with the work you actually need done
Map the workflow that matters most before comparing app labels. Consider whether work begins in email, scheduling, documents, a browser, voice messages, or a workspace such as Notion, then favor an option that fits that starting point instead of choosing on general AI appeal alone.
Decide how much autonomy you want
Some users want help thinking through a plan, while others want an assistant that can implement repeatable tasks. The more an AI system acts on your behalf, the more important it is to understand approvals, correction paths, and ways to pause activity. The NIST AI Risk Management Framework is a useful reference for thinking about oversight and risk.
Compare free access with real usage
A free listing is a helpful starting point, but test the tasks that determine your decision rather than relying on the label alone. Check account requirements, usage limits, and whether the workflow you care about is available under the relevant access tier before moving important work.
Check data handling and connections
When an assistant touches messages, voice notes, documents, or task systems, review permissions, retention, export options, and the effort required to keep information synchronized. The FTC privacy and security guidance provides practical baseline questions for evaluating privacy and security practices.
